调亏灌溉是70年代由澳大利亚持续灌溉农业研究所最早提出来的,基于植物生理学和生物化学知识,认为对于有些作物,由于其自身的生理或生化作用受到遗传因素或生长激素的影响,如果在其生长发育某些阶段施加一定程度的水分胁迫,可以增加作物后期的抗旱能力。同时能够引起同化物在不同器官间的重新分配,降低营养器官的生长冗余,提高作物的经济系数,并可通过对其内部生化作用的影响,改善某些作物的品质,起到节水、优质、高效的作用。90年代后期,国内学者开始在大田作物上进行试验,也
Regulated deficit irrigation was firstly proposed by Australian Institute of Continuing Irrigation and Agriculture in the 1970s. Based on the knowledge of plant physiology and biochemistry, it is considered that some crops are affected by genetic factors or growth hormone due to their own physiological or biochemical effects, Some stages of its growth and development exert a certain degree of water stress, can increase the late drought resistance. At the same time, it can cause the redistribution of the assimilates among different organs, reduce the growth redundancy of vegetative organs and increase the economic coefficient of the crop, and can improve the quality of some crops through the influence of its internal biochemical actions, High-quality, efficient role.
